New survey released to mark Adult Safeguarding Day.
The Kildare area has the highest level of Adult abuse reporting in Ireland.
It is one of the findings of a new survey released to mark Adult Safeguarding Day.
Adult abuse is described as when someone’s rights, wellbeing or safety are not respected by another person.
Abuse may be emotional, psychological, financial, physical, sexual or cyber.
The survey found that more than two-fifths of people in Ireland have personally experienced some form of adult abuse, but few actually report it.
Celine O’Connor, HSE Principal Social Worker for the HSE Kildare, West-Wicklow, says reporting is vital.
